Why is office cleaning crucial in winter?
Winter brings its own set of challenges for office cleaning. Between rain, snow, road salt and dry heating air, workspaces get dirty faster and require special attention. Rigorous maintenance not only helps to maintain a pleasant environment, it also protects employees' health by limiting the spread of seasonal viruses.
The main challenges of winter cleaning
Dirt and moisture build-up
Office entrances are the first to be affected by winter conditions. Slush, mud and salt leave marks on the floor and can damage floor coverings.
Indoor air quality
Central heating reduces ambient humidity, encouraging the accumulation of dust and the circulation of microbes. Poorly maintained ventilation systems can worsen the situation.
Spread of disease
Winter is a good time for viruses such as the flu and the common cold. Shared workspaces and contact surfaces must be cleaned and disinfected regularly to limit the risk of contamination.
Our tips for effective winter cleaning
Reinforce maintenance of entrances and floors
Install absorbent mats to reduce humidity and dirt.
Clean floors several times a day in bad weather.
Use products adapted to floors to avoid damage caused by salt.
Ensure healthy indoor air
Air offices daily to renew the air.
Clean ventilation system filters.
Use humidifiers to maintain optimum humidity levels.
Disinfect work areas
Frequently clean door handles, switches, keyboards and telephones.
Make hydro-alcoholic solutions available to employees.
Reinforce cleaning of washrooms and break areas.
Adapt cleaning frequency
Increase cleaning frequency according to weather conditions.
Implement regular monitoring of specific office needs.
